Why is Commercial Window Replacement Important?
The Double Glazing Benefits of commercial window replacement extend far beyond simple aesthetics. Here are some reasons why businesses may find themselves considering this important upgradation:

Energy Efficiency: Older windows often suffer from bad insulation, leading to substantial heating & cooling expenses. Updating to energy-efficient windows can help reduce these expenditures substantially.

Enhanced Aesthetics: New windows can boost the overall appearance of a structure, which is crucial for drawing in renters and clients.

Increased Property Value: Replacing windows can increase the marketplace worth of a home, making it more enticing to prospective buyers.

Improved Security: Modern windows feature improved locking mechanisms and reinforced glass, supplying much better security against burglaries.

Noise Reduction: Quality replacement windows can considerably minimize outside noise, contributing to a more enjoyable indoor environment for workers and customers.
Types of Commercial Windows
When considering window replacement, it's necessary to comprehend the various types readily available:

The option of product for commercial windows can significantly affect efficiency, maintenance, and cost. Here are some typical materials:
Vinyl: Affordable Double Glazing and energy-efficient, vinyl is resistant to wetness and requires minimal maintenance.Aluminum: Known for its strength and durability, aluminum frames are often used in modern designs however may need thermal breaks to improve energy performance.Wood: Offers excellent insulation homes and aesthetic appeal but may require more maintenance.Fiberglass: Strong and energy-efficient, fiberglass frames have very low thermal growth homes.The Window Replacement Process

The timeline can differ based on the size of the project and the kind of windows being set up. Normally, a Window Design replacement can take anywhere from a couple of days to several weeks.
2. What is the average cost of commercial window replacement?
Depending upon the type and variety of Storm Windows Installation, expenses can vary considerably. Prices normally varies from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1000 per window, consisting of materials and labor.
3. Are energy-efficient windows worth the cost?
Yes, they can substantially lower energy bills and typically come with warranties and tax rewards, making them a beneficial financial investment over time.
4. How do I know when to change my windows?
Indications such as drafts, condensation between panes, and noticeable rot or damage indicate that it might be time for a replacement.
5. Can I change windows in a historical structure?
Yes, but it's important to guarantee that replacements meet local historic conservation guidelines. Seek advice from local authorities or specialists.
